Default RE: Adding weight for cg


ORIGINAL: Pillzee

Thanks Minn. I guess i will go pick up some fishing lead weights. I will figure out how much I need then melt it into a solid block to make it easier for mounting.
As long as you melt them yourself (that's what I do too), go to any place that sells car tires. When they balance a tire, they remove any old weights and toss them into a bucket. Then they have to dispose of them properly (read that as, it's a pain in the butt).

So they are usually happy to give you a few free handfulls just for the asking!
